Lord Peter Views the Body by Dorothy L. Sayers is a celebrated collection of twelve detective stories featuring Lord Peter Wimsey. Written by Dorothy L. Sayers, the volume showcases Wimsey’s wit, intelligence and aristocratic charm as he unravels mysteries ranging from ingenious murders to baffling disappearances. Demonstrating Sayers’ literary sophistication and inventive plotting, it remains one of the finest collections from the Golden Age of detective fiction and an enduring favourite among collectors.
